Mortal Shell 2 is an upcoming Soulslike action-RPG for PS5, Xbox Series X/S, and PC, set to be released on August 20. Recently rated 'M' by the ESRB, it promises intense violence and mature themes, surpassing its predecessor in every way. The game is currently in Open Beta on Steam, allowing players to experience its thrilling dark fantasy setting and gameplay mechanics firsthand.
Mortal Shell 2's detailed ESRB rating indicates a shift towards more mature content compared to its predecessor.
